Top 5 2D Anime Games in Czech Republic - Q2 2022 Performance
In Q2 2022, the top 5 2D Anime Games in the Czech Republic displayed varied trends in we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at their performance.
In Q2 2022, the top 5 2D Anime Games on a unified platform in the Czech Republic exhibited diverse trends in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, provides a comprehensive overview of these applications' performance.
Sweet Girl: Doll Dress Up ASMR saw its weekly revenue begin in June, peaking at $32 in the week of June 20 before dropping to $2 by the end of the month. Weekly downloads started strong in early May with 4.1K but gradually declined to 1K by the end of June. Weekly active users showed a more stable trend, starting at 2.8K in early May and increasing to 7.1K by late June.
Gacha Life experienced a notable revenue spike of $50 in the week of May 23, with smaller peaks of $18 in the following weeks. Weekly downloads rem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 769 and 1.2K throughout the quarter. The app's weekly active users also exhibited stability, ranging from 13.3K to 14.7K.
Gacha Club did not generate any revenue during Q2 2022. However, its weekly downloads varied, with a low of 600 and a high of 967. The app maintained a steady number of weekly active users, fluctuating between 12.5K and 13.7K over the quarter.
Trading Legend recorded a significant revenue peak of $2.7K in the week of May 9, followed by a gradual decline to $634 by the end of June. Weekly downloads showed a downward trend, starting at 2.2K in late March and dropping to single digits by late June. The app's weekly active users mirrored this decline, decreasing from 1.9K to 557 over the same period.
YOYO Doll School life Dress up did not generate any revenue in June 2022. Weekly downloads peaked at nearly 5K in mid-June before declining to 1.3K by the end of the month. Weekly active users increased from 291 in early June to a high of 7K in mid-June, then slightly decreased to 6.7K by the end of the month.
